Comprehending Double GlazingWhat is Double Glazing?
Double glazing refers to using 2 panes of glass in a window frame, with an area in between them filled with air or gas (like argon) to improve insulation. This style reduces heat loss during winter and helps keep homes cooler in summer.

When considering double glazing, it's important to weigh expenses versus advantages. Below is a table showing approximate costs for different window types and materials.
Window TypeMaterialRate Range (per system)NotesSash WindowsuPVC₤ 200 - ₤ 600Most typical type, flexible.Sash WindowsTimber₤ 400 - ₤ 800Classic look, needs upkeep.Tilt and TurnuPVC/Aluminum₤ 300 - ₤ 700Versatile opening, fantastic for cleansing.Bay WindowsuPVC/Timber₤ 600 - ₤ 1200Adds area and light, more complicated installation.Bi-Folding DoorsAluminum₤ 800 - ₤ 2000Expansive opening, high-end option.Typical Installation Costs

Is double glazing worth the financial investment?
Yes, while the initial cost may be higher than single glazing, the long-term energy savings and increased home worth make it a beneficial investment.
2. For how long does double glazing last?
A lot of double glazing units last between 20 to 35 years, depending on the quality and maintenance.

5. Exists a difference in between uPVC and aluminum frames?
Yes, uPVC frames are usually more affordable, supply outstanding insulation, and require less maintenance. Aluminum frames tend to be more durable but are usually more pricey.
